French Structuralism and Poststructuralism
Status: optional
Recommended Year of Study: 4
Recommended Semester: 7
ECTS Credits Allocated: 6.00
Pre-requisites: Student should be previously introduced to the key tendencies in contemporary philosophy.

Course objectives: Introduction to key intentions of these directions in contemporary philosophy, with their inspiration in structural linguistics, their importance for orientation in the discussions on modernism and postmodernism.

Course description: Incentives from structural linguistics and semiology; idea of sign structure and its relation to genetic and historical research; idea of differentiality, critique of essentialism, criticism of traditional conception of self-reflexive and self-identical subject; genealogical and deconstructivistic critique of the ruling forms of rationality and their significance for postmodernistic critiques of mind; criticism of the ruling economy of sign; the idea of simulation and its importance for critical analysis of contemporary mass-media and information culture.

Learning Outcomes: Mastering the methods of structural analysis, and learning about the capabilities of their application in different theoretical contexts (philosophy, anthropology, psychoanalysis, critique of ideology
